Joint-Venture Promotion
A marketing strategy where two or more parties collaborate to promote a product, service, or venture, sharing resources and benefits.
Sales Promotions
Short-term marketing strategies aimed at stimulating demand for a product or service, often through discounts, coupons, or special offers.
B2B Programs
Business-to-Business programs are initiatives or strategies developed for transactions or engagements between companies.
